front fan knob broken? pls help

Dear all,
I have a toyota yaris year 2006.
I recently tried to move my fan air circulation from outside to recirculate. However, the knob got stuck and while trying to unstuck them, it broke down. I cannot change the air management option anymore and it is stuck on recirculate air.

I have looked into youtube and some forum and noted someone has been able to repair this knob by removing the front cover and by replugging the connector.

However I am unable to remove the front cover of the fan. I have been able to remove only the side cover, but the front cover seems to be stuck by the radio cover, which seems impossible to dislodge, without first unscrewing the radio.

You just need to pull off those black vertical pieces first. Get your fingers under the bottom edge by the storage pocket and pull out. Once they are off, the silver piece with the knobs pulls straight off.

hi. I have indeed been able to remove the vertical pieces with no problem (number 1 & 2 as per picture above). However the number 3 should be removed to access the knob. since when I check the knob cover, it seems that it is in fact clip also to the radio cover.
That is correct. You will need to remove the radio mounting screws and pull the radio forward a bit to allow the AC panel to come off.
